T1 vs DSL
At what point should you optimize Internet service performance to a speedier and more trustworthy T1 line? When searching for possibly swapping out your existing DSL connection, it is important to consider several different issues. Financial loss materializing during the event of connectivity loss and reliability are the largest issues to consider in the case of both large and small business functions. High-speed Internet is crucial for a large number of companies to earn business over e-mail, video conferencing, and voice-over-Internet telephone programs. Should an outage arise, your business could be impacted at all stages.
Normally, a T1 connection will deliver a stable bi-directional speed of 1.5 Mbps. Then again, the bandwidth that a DSL connection can work is totally based upon the mileage from the DSLAM, which is the actual equipment device situated in your neighborhood by the local phone company. DSL's maximum reach is 18,000 feet. After that, the twisted pair line's power is too weak to faithfully send data.
Customer service is an additional feature that differs between a T1 and DSL line. You will find there is a technical support team supporting a T1 line. This expert help guarantees a 99.99% quality of service, around the clock, everyday of the week, due to the fact that the service is checked continuously. With the first sign associated with an outage, the specialists instantly start to troubleshooting to identify the reason behind the problem and repair it. However, DSL service demands that you act by calling customer service then waiting on hold until a customer support agent is available to answer your call and be of assistance to you.
Price is the final distinction between a T1 and DSL line. Depending on the type of package you have, the cost of DSL service may well be between $19 and $79 monthly. As recently as a few years ago a T1 line price was an average of about $1,000 monthly fee. This was beyond the budgets of numerous businesses. Ever since then the expense of a T1 connection now is priced starting from high $300's to the low $700's per month, which renders it a choice that small businesses and even home offices are more likely to consider. A T1 line is more pricey than DSL, but what is the real expense to your company in case your Internet connection goes down?
